DESCRIPTION
The VGRS ECU (front steering control ECU) receives signals from the ECM, TCM, skid control ECU (brake actuator assembly), yaw rate sensor, steering sensor and power steering ECU assembly via CAN communication. When DTCs indicating a CAN communication system malfunction are output, repair the CAN communication system first.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| U0100/56 | Lost Communication with ECM / PCM "A" |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). The signal from the ECM is lost. | ECM CAN communication system | Comes on | Engine switch on (IG) again |
| U0101/56 | Lost Communication with TCM | Both conditions are met for approximately 12 seconds or more: The engine switch is on (IG). The signal from the TCM is lost. | TCM CAN communication system | Comes on | Engine switch on (IG) again |
| U0125/56 | Lost Communication with Yaw Rate Sensor Module | Both conditions are met for approximately 12 seconds or more: The engine switch is on (IG). The signal from the yaw rate sensor is lost. | Yaw rate sensor CAN communication system | Comes on | Engine switch on (IG) again |
| U0126/56 | Lost Communication with Steering Angle Sensor Module |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). The signal from the steering sensor is lost. | Steering sensor CAN communication system | Comes on | Engine switch on (IG) again |
| U0129/56 | Lost Communication with Brake System Control Module |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). The signal from the skid control ECU (brake actuator assembly) is lost. | Skid control ECU (Brake actuator assembly) CAN communication system | Comes on | Engine switch on (IG) again |
| U0131/56 | Lost Communication with Power Steering Control Module |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). The signal from the power steering ECU assembly is lost. | Power steering ECU assembly CAN communication system | Comes on | Engine switch on (IG) again |
When the VGRS ECU (front steering control ECU) detects a problem with the power steering ECU assembly via CAN communication, this DTC is stored.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15CA/79 | EPS System Malfunction |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). Information regarding a power steering ECU assembly internal malfunction is received via CAN communication. | Power steering ECU assembly | Comes on | Engine switch on (IG) again |
The VGRS ECU (front steering control ECU) monitors terminal PIG (motor power source voltage) in order to detect malfunctions in the power supply relay (located inside the VGRS ECU (front steering control ECU)).
If the VGRS ECU (front steering control ECU) detects a malfunction, it turns the master warning light on, and stores these DTCs.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15C7/78 | DC Motor Power Source Voltage | Both conditions are met for approximately 2.4 seconds or more: The engine switch is on (IG). When the PIG voltage is 18.5 V or higher or 7 V or less, an open or short in the PIG circuit, or an internal malfunction in the ECU is detected. | VGRS fuse Battery Charging system V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
| C15C8/79 | Power Supply Relay Failure | All conditions are met for approximately 1.5 seconds or more: The engine switch is on (IG). Control has not started. An open / short in the PIG circuit or an internal malfunction in the ECU is detected. | VGRS fuse Battery Charging system V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|

The VGRS ECU (front steering control ECU) monitors the IG power supply voltage.
If the VGRS ECU (front steering control ECU) detects a malfunction, it turns the master warning light on, and stores DTC C15C6/77.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15C6/77 | IG Power Supply Voltage | Both conditions are met for approximately 3 seconds or more: The engine switch is on (IG). When the IG voltage is 4 V or less or 18.5 V or higher, an open or short in the IG circuit or an internal malfunction in the ECU is detected. | IG1 NO. 2 fuse Battery Charging system V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|

The VGRS ECU (front steering control ECU) detects a vehicle speed error by receiving an error signal from the skid control ECU (brake actuator assembly) via CAN communication.
If the VGRS ECU (front steering control ECU) detects this error signal, it turns the master warning light on, and stores this DTC.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15C3/75 | Brake System Control Module | All conditions are met: 3 seconds or more after the engine switch is turned on (IG). Power source voltage at 10 to 16 V. Information regarding a vehicle speed signal malfunction is received for approximately 3 seconds or more from the skid control ECU (brake actuator assembly) via CAN communication or there is a VDIM monitoring malfunction. | Skid control ECU (Brake actuator assembly) | Comes on | Engine switch on (IG) again |
| C15CB/84 | VSC System Malfunction | All conditions are met: 3 seconds or more after the engine switch is turned on (IG). Power source voltage at 10 to 16 V. Information regarding a skid control ECU (brake actuator assembly) internal malfunction is received 3 seconds or more via CAN communication. | Skid control ECU (Brake actuator assembly) | Comes on | Engine switch on (IG) again |
The VGRS ECU (front steering control ECU) detects a steering sensor malfunction by receiving an error signal from the steering sensor via CAN communication. If the VGRS ECU (front steering control ECU) detects this error signal, it turns the master warning light on, and stores these DTCs.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15C1/74 | Steering Angle Sensor | All conditions are met for approximately 3 seconds or more: 1 seconds or more after the engine switch is turned on (IG). Power source voltage at 10 to 16 V. Information regarding a steering sensor internal malfunction is received via CAN communication. | Steering sensor | Comes on | Engine switch on (IG) again |
| C15C2/74 | Steering Angle Sensor B+ | All conditions are met for approximately 2 seconds or more: 1 seconds or more after the engine switch is turned on (IG). Power source voltage at 10 to 16 V. Information regarding a steering sensor internal malfunction (+B open circuit) is received via CAN communication. | Steering sensor | Comes on | Engine switch on (IG) again |
If the VGRS ECU (front steering control ECU) detects an internal malfunction, it turns the master warning light on, and stores DTC C15B4/71.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15B4/71 | ECU Malfunction(Actuator Angle Record) | The memorized actuator angle value cannot be confirmed immediately after the engine switch is turned on (IG). | VGRS ECU (front steering control ECU) | Comes on | After clearing DTCs, perform actuator angle neutral point calibration. |
If the VGRS ECU (front steering control ECU) detects an internal malfunction, it turns the master warning light on, and stores these DTCs.
When DTC C15B3/73 is stored, the master warning light is not illuminated and the VGRS system continues to operate.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15B1/71 | ECU Malfunction(CPU) | When the engine switch is turned on (IG), the VGRS ECU (front steering control ECU) detects an internal malfunction. | VGRS ECU (front steering control ECU) | Comes on | Engine switch on (IG) again |
| C15B2/72 | ECU Malfunction(Internal Line) | When the engine switch is turned on (IG), the VGRS ECU (front steering control ECU) detects an internal malfunction. | VGRS ECU (front steering control ECU) | Comes on | Engine switch on (IG) again |
| C15B3/73 | ECU Malfunction(Substrate Temperature Sensor) | When the engine switch is turned on (IG), the VGRS ECU (front steering control ECU) detects an internal malfunction. | VGRS ECU (front steering control ECU) | Does not come on | Engine switch on (IG) again |
| C15B5/82 | ECU Malfunction(Flash Memory) | When the engine switch is turned on (IG), the VGRS ECU (front steering control ECU) detects an internal malfunction. | VGRS ECU (front steering control ECU) | Comes on | Engine switch on (IG) again |
| C15B6/83 | ECU Malfunction(EEPROM) | When the engine switch is turned on (IG), the VGRS ECU (front steering control ECU) detects an internal malfunction. | VGRS ECU (front steering control ECU) | Comes on | Engine switch on (IG) again |
If the VGRS ECU (front steering control ECU) detects a malfunction in the lock mechanism, it turns the master warning light on, and stores DTC C15A5/65.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15A5/65 | Lock Mechanism Circuit | Both conditions are met for approximately 0.025 seconds or more: The engine switch is on (IG). A short in the motor circuit or an internal malfunction in the ECU is detected.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
When the VGRS system is normal, the steering actuator assembly conducts current from the VGRS ECU (front steering control ECU) to the steering actuator solenoid to release the lock mechanism, enabling motor operation.
The steering actuator assembly does not operate under any of the following conditions
- The engine switch is off.
- The motor in the actuator is locked by the lock mechanism to prevent rotation (fail-safe function).
- The system is being protected from overheating (fail-safe function).
If the VGRS ECU (front steering control ECU) detects a malfunction in the steering actuator lock mechanism or a motor rotation angle error, it stores these DTCs.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15A4/64 | Motor Rotation Angle Malfunction | After starting the engine, the "Actuator Target Angle" and "Actuator Angle" have a difference of 0.5 degrees or more for 1 second or more. | Steering actuator assembly | Comes on | Engine switch on (IG) again |
| C15A9/66 | Lock Holder Deviation Detection | After the engine switch is turned off, the lock pin is inserted with the steering wheel near the neutral position (within 90 degrees of 0), the "Actuator Angle" and "Deep Groove Electrical Angle Position" are at 40 degrees or more | Steering actuator assembly | Comes on | After clearing DTCs, perform actuator angle neutral point calibration. |
| C15AA/66 | Lock Mechanism Release Incomplete | After starting the engine, the "Motor q Axis Target Voltage" is 1.8 V or higher and 15 seconds or more elapse, or the "Motor q Axis Target Voltage" is 0.6 V or higher and 180 seconds or more elapse. | Steering actuator assembly | Comes on | After clearing DTCs, perform actuator angle neutral point calibration. |
| C15AB/66 | Lock Mechanism Insertion | After the engine switch is turned on (IG), when the motor is operating to confirm the lock pin insertion, the "Motor q Axis Target Voltage" is below 2 V. | Steering actuator assembly | Comes on | After clearing DTCs, perform actuator angle neutral point calibration. |
The steering actuator assembly drives the internal motor using the current output from the VGRS ECU (front steering control ECU) to change the relative angle between the tire angle and steering wheel angle.
The motor rotation angle sensor in the steering actuator assembly detects the motor rotation angle and outputs this information to the VGRS ECU (front steering control ECU).
If the VGRS ECU (front steering control ECU) detects a malfunction in the motor rotation angle sensor circuit, it stores DTC C15A3/63.
The test mode DTC C15C5/69 is only stored during test mode.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15A3/63 | Motor Rotation Angle Not Detected | All conditions are met for approximately 0.03 seconds or more: 2 seconds or more elapse after turning the engine switch on (IG). 2 seconds or more elapse with the power source voltage at 10 V or higher. A problem with the motor rotation angle sensor is detected.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
| C15C5/69 | Motor Rotation Signal Not Detected | The system enters test mode.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Test mode code |

If the VGRS ECU (front steering control ECU) detects excessive current, it stores DTC C15A1/61, turns on the master warning light.
If the VGRS ECU (front steering control ECU) detects excessive current flowing into the steering actuator assembly or an internal malfunction, it turns the master warning light on, and stores DTC C15A2/62.
If the VGRS ECU (front steering control ECU) detects a malfunction in the motor drive circuit, it turns the master warning light on, and stores DTC C15A6/62.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C15A1/61 | Short in Motor Circuit | Either condition is met: After the engine switch is turned on (IG), a short in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 1.2 seconds or more before control starts. After the engine switch is turned on (IG), a short in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 0.03 seconds or more.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
| C15A2/62 | Open in Motor Circuit | Either condition is met: After the engine switch is turned on (IG), an open in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 1.2 seconds or more before control starts. After the engine switch is turned on (IG), an open in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 0.03 seconds or more.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
| C15A6/62 | Actuator Motor Power Distribution Malfunction | Either condition is met: After the engine switch is turned on (IG), an open in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 1.2 seconds or more before control starts. After the engine switch is turned on (IG), an open in the motor circuit or an internal ECU (motor drive circuit) malfunction continues for 0.03 seconds or more. | Steering actuator assembly V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|

Signal transmission between the VGRS ECU (front steering control ECU) and steering sensor is performed via serial communication.
If a serial communication error occurs between the VGRS ECU (front steering control ECU) and steering sensor, the ECU stores DTC C1595/55.
The test mode DTC C15C4/68 is only stored during test mode.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C1595/55 | Lost Communication with Steering Angle Sensor Module(SIL) | With the engine switch on (IG) and a power source voltage of 10 V or more, serial communication from the steering sensor is interrupted for 3 seconds or more. | Steering sensor VGRS ECU (front steering control ECU) Harness or connector | Comes on | Engine switch on (IG) again |
| C15C4/68 | Steering Signal Not Detected | The system enters test mode. | Steering sensor VGRS ECU (front steering control ECU) Harness or connector | Test mode code |

If the VGRS ECU (front steering control ECU) detects a steering actuator standard position error, it stores DTC C1593/53.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C1593/53 | Actuator Standard Position | Lock holder deviation is detected when the neutral point calibration value is calculated during actuator angle neutral point calibration. | Steering actuator assembly | Comes on | Engine switch on (IG) again |
When the actuator angle is initialized or the VGRS ECU (front steering control ECU) is replaced (the VGRS ECU [front steering control ECU] determines that actuator angle neutral point calibration has not been performed), a DTC is stored.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C1591/51 | Actuator Neutral Position Calibration Undone | Actuator angle neutral calibration has not been performed. | There is no malfunction if this DTC is not output again after performing VGRS system calibration | Comes on | Perform actuator angle neutral point calibration. |
The VGRS ECU (front steering control ECU) first checks the actuator angle neutral point calibration flag after entering test mode. If the ECU detects that steering actuator angle neutral point calibration is incomplete twice, it stores DTC C1592/52.
| DTC No. | Detection Item | DTC Detection Condition | Trouble Area | Warning Indicate | Return-to-normal Condition |
|---|---|---|---|---|---|
| C1592/52 | Actuator Neutral Position Calibration Incomplete | The VGRS ECU (front steering control ECU) detects that steering actuator angle neutral point calibration is incomplete twice. | Steering actuator assembly VGRS ECU (front steering control ECU) | Comes on | After clearing DTCs, perform actuator angle neutral point calibration. |
